Scrumptious Bacon Double Cheese Burger

Jennifer McDonald
I guarantee you, this bacon double cheese burger will satisfy your craving for a good burger. It's loaded with two burgers and a handful of bacon.

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 15 minutes
Total Time 25 minutes
Course Main Course
Cuisine American
Servings 3 people
Calories 727 kcal

Ingredients
 
 

  • 500 grams ground beef
  • 4 rashes bacon
  • 4 medium tomatoes
  • 1 handful Iceberg lettuce
  • ¾ medium red onion
  • ¼ medium onion
  • ½ tablespoon salt
  • 1 cube chicken seasoning
  • ½ tablespoon cayenne pepper
  • ½ teaspoon ground black pepper
  • 3 slices cheese
  • 1 tablespoon hot sauce
  • 1 tablespoon mustard
  • 1 tablespoon ketchup
  • 3 medium burger buns

Instructions
 

  • Finely chop both types of onion and your tomatoes.
  • Place the ground beef into a bowl and add the pepper, salt and Maggi cube. Now massage all the seasoning using your hands.
  • Add the onions into the meat mixture add massage it in.
  • Grab a portion of the meat, roll it into a ball and flatten it into a burger shape using your hands.
  • Once you’re finished, place the burgers to one side.
  • Heat 3 tablespoons of oil. Once heated, place the bacon into the pan and leave it to cook for about 2 minutes on each side. Then put it to one side.
  • Now add 1 cup of olive oil into the pan, wait for it to heat up, then place the burgers in.Cook for 5 minutes per side or until a dark brown.
  • Once the burgers are cooked, place them on a paper towel to allow any excess oil to drain out.
  • Pour some hot sauce onto lettuce, then the burger, cheese, tomatoes, bacon, and another burger.
  • Squeeze the mustard and ketchup onto it before serving.
